Resilient Banking refers to financial systems designed to withstand economic shocks, cyber threats, and operational disruptions. It uses advanced risk management, digital redundancies, and adaptive strategies to maintain stability. Banks, regulators, and customers benefit through enhanced trust, uninterrupted services, and safeguarded assets during crises.
